Richard Perle - A Biography
- Former Chairman of the Defense
Policy Board. He recently resigned chairmanship
to assume member status.
- Research fellow at the “American
Enterprise Institute for Public Policy Research”
- Areas of expertise include defense
intelligence, national security, Europe &
the Middle East and the Russian region.
- Member of the Board of Advisors
of “ Foundation
for Defense of Democracy “ (FDD)
- Former chairman and chief executive
officer of Hollinger Digital, Inc., the media
management and investment arm of Hollinger International,
a newspaper publishing company
- Former director of Jerusalem Post
- Former assistant Secretary of Defence
for international security policy, 1981-1987
- Former staff aid to U.S. Senator
Henry Jackson, 1969-1980
- Producer, PBS, The Gulf Crisis:
The Road to War, 1992.
- M.A., political science, Princeton
University
- B.A., University of Southern
California.
He is a member of the Defense Policy
Board, the government appointed group that advises
the U.S. Defense Secretary.
Richard Perle resides in Washington D.C.
